Expanding gases can lead to which dangerous atmosphere during a hazmat incident?

Explanation:
When considering the dangers associated with expanding gases during a hazardous materials incident, a significant concern is the potential for an asphyxiating atmosphere. Expanding gases can rapidly displace breathable air, leading to a reduction in oxygen levels in a confined space or area. This depletion of oxygen can create an environment where human life is at risk, as insufficient oxygen can lead to suffocation or unconsciousness. As gases expand, they may also occupy more volume without a corresponding increase in pressure, potentially causing an oxygen-deficient atmosphere where people present may experience difficulty breathing. Understanding this risk is critical for first responders and individuals working in environments where hazardous materials may be present. Recognizing the implications of expanding gases aids in proper safety assessment and measures like ventilating the area or using breathing apparatus when necessary to prevent asphyxiation.
